Petroleum Pump System Operators, Refinery Operators, and Gaugers Salary in Michigan
Source: Bureau of Labor Statistics, May 2024
Median in Michigan
$87,390
National Median
$97,540
Employment
170
Entry Level (10th)
$50,060
Top Earners (90th)
$107,780
How Michigan Compares
Michigan pays $10,150 less than the national median for petroleum pump system operators, refinery operators, and gaugerss.
There are 0.038 petroleum pump system operators, refinery operators, and gaugers jobs per 1,000 workers in Michigan (location quotient: 0.17).
